Excise staff step up raids on IDL in border areas

Srikakulam: The district prohibition and excise (P&E) officials have intensified raids and vigil on illicitly distilled liquor (IDL) and violation of licence rules. Border areas with Odisha State located in Gajapathi, Rayagadha and Ganjam are known for IDL making and transporting into Srikakulam district.

In the wake of elections, to prevent the IDL transportation, the officials have intensified raids. From January to till March 22 this year, the officials booked 179 cases and arrested 132 persons, seized nine vehicles regarding IDL making, transportation, selling and destroyed 3,386.03 litres of IDL. Relating to IDL, in total 223 cases were booked for preparation and storage of fermented jiggery wash (FJW) which is a key material for manufacturing of IDL and destroyed 1,56,770 litres of FJW.

Regarding belt shops, they booked 424 cases, arrested 423 persons and seized 700.29 litres of IML and 164.81 litres of beer. Another 51 cases booked for violation of licence norms. The officials cancelled Ravi Teja Bar and Restaurant's licence in Amudalavalasa town and in Palasa town, they cancelled Bhanu Wines licence. Another two cases were registered for dilution of liquor and one case regarding sales of non-duty paid liquor (NDPL).

Speaking to The Hans India, Prohibition and Excise Deputy Commissioner S Sukesh said the department has registered 887 cases and arrested 618 persons. Bound over cases were registered against 807 persons regarding IDL and belt shops management, he stated and added "We have conducted joint meetings with Odisha State officials and conducting joint raids also."
